    Why Harry Maguire goal in Man Utd 5-2 Ipswich was allowed to stand

    The handball law often serves to confuse supporters – and it reared its head again as Harry Maguire celebrated putting Manchester United in front against Ipswich Town.

    The ball came off the United defender’s arm, before he then moved a few yards forward into the box and his shot found its way into the back of the net.

    Surely the goal would be ruled out. After all, any handball by the scorer means the goal must be disallowed.

    Apart from one very important point – Maguire did not actually score the goal.

    Maguire’s effort was going well wide, and deflected into the back of the net off Jacob Greaves. It was officially an own goal.

    There are three exemptions for when accidental handball by the scorer does not count:

    The video assistant referee Jarred Gillett said to referee Craig Pawson: “It’s an own goal and the accidental handball is not punishable, so we recommend you award the goal.”

    Indeed, the goal could have been disallowed had the VAR felt it was deliberate handball by Maguire.

    Manchester United went on to win the game 5-2 thanks to a Bruno Fernandes hat-trick.

    It is rare but we saw a similar situation in January 2023 with a goal for Brentford against Liverpool.

    The ball accidentally came off the arm of Ben Mee and ended up in the back of the net, but it was not going towards goal and deflected off Ibrahima Konate for an own goal.
